fbpx

Что такое API и зачем необходимы интеграции

Deal Score0
Deal Score0

Что такое API и зачем необходимы интеграции

API является собой совокупность правил для взаимодействия софтверных программ. Аббревиатура расшифровывается как Application Programming Interface. Технология позволяет различным программам передавать данными без вмешательства человека. Программисты формируют особые точки доступа к опциям своих программ.

Интеграции связывают разрозненные сервисы в единую экосистему. Предприятия приобретают опцию автоматизировать перенос данных между системами. Пользователи сберегают время на мануальном вводе данных. Бизнес снижает число ошибок при обработке обращений.

Современные веб-сервисы покердом интенсивно применяют софтверные интерфейсы для расширения функций. Банковские приложения интегрируются к платежным системам. Интернет-магазины синхронизируют складские остатки с системами учета. Социальные сети открывают доступ к профилям для сторонних разработчиков.

Технология дает опции для формирования многокомпонентных решений. Стартапы разрабатывают продукты на основе действующих площадок. Софтверные интерфейсы сделались стандартом диджитал экономики.

Как разные приложения делятся информацией

Программы отправляют данные через особые запросы по сети. Одно программа передает сообщение с заданными параметрами. Второе программа принимает запрос, обрабатывает его и выдает результат. Весь механизм происходит по предварительно заданным принципам.

Трансфер данными использует стандартные протоколы передачи данных. Чаще всего применяется протокол HTTP, знакомый по работе веб-сайтов покердом. Запросы содержат адрес получателя, тип действия и нужные параметры. Ответы включают запрашиваемую информацию или сообщение об неточности.

Формат данных выполняет ключевую значение в коммуникации между системами. Востребованным форматом стал JSON – текстовый формат для организованной информации. Альтернативой служит XML с более четкой структурой. Оба формата обеспечивают передавать комплексные структуры данных.

Каждая приложение является либо клиентом, либо сервером в процессе взаимодействия. Клиент создает запрос и ожидает приема данных. Сервер получает поступающие обращения и генерирует ответы. Функции могут варьироваться в зависимости от варианта коммуникации. Такая организация гарантирует адаптивность формирования децентрализованных систем.

Что подразумевает API на реальности

Программный интерфейс pokerdom функционирует как меню в ресторане. Гость замечает список предлагаемых блюд и делает заказ. Кухня готовит еду по определенным инструкциям. Клиент принимает готовое блюдо, не вникая в детали создания.

Программисты описывают доступные опции и способы их вызова. Документация детализирует адреса обращений, обязательные параметры и структуру ответов. Программисты анализируют спецификацию и интегрируют вызовы в свой код. Приложение приступает задействовать функции стороннего сервиса.

Практическое применение охватывает массу вариантов. Мобильное приложение банка затребует баланс счёта с сервера. Ресурс бронирования отелей уточняет наличие незанятых номеров в базе данных. Навигатор получает данные о пробках от картографического сервиса. Музыкальный плеер загружает обложки альбомов из внешнего хранилища.

Интерфейс скрывает внутреннюю логику функционирования системы. Сторонние программисты получают доступ исключительно к разрешенным функциям. Собственник сервиса контролирует, какие информацию можно затребовать. Такой метод оберегает конфиденциальную сведения и гарантирует устойчивость работы основной системы.

Почему сервисы не работают автономно

Нынешние пользователи покердом казино требуют бесшовного взаимодействия при работе с диджитал продуктами. Автономные системы формируют барьеры и тормозят реализацию операций. Предприятия утрачивают клиентов из-за повторного ввода идентичной сведений. Интеграция устраняет разрывы между приложениями.

Специализация заставляет сервисы коммуницировать друг с другом. Один продукт справляется с платежами, другой – с транспортировкой товаров. Создание комплексного решения нуждается значительных средств. Подключение имеющихся сервисов ускоряет запуск свежих функций.

Главные причины необходимости интеграций:

  • Автоматизация рутинных процессов сокращает давление на работников.
  • Синхронизация сведений устраняет разночтения в учёте.
  • Увеличение функциональности без внутренней разработки.
  • Улучшение качества сервиса заказчиков.
  • Сокращение эксплуатационных издержек.

Экосистемный принцип превратился конкурентным достоинством на рынке. Платформы открывают интерфейсы для контрагентов и разработчиков. Создаются свежие сервисы на базе существующей архитектуры. Пользователи обретают больше опций в привычной среде.

Как интеграции упрощают деятельность пользователя

Автоматическая синхронизация избавляет от мануального перемещения информации между программами покердом. Контакты из телефонной книги возникают в мессенджерах без дополнительных манипуляций. Фотографии с камеры сохраняются в облачном архиве. Календарь отображает мероприятия из электронной почты.

Единая аутентификация позволяет входить в различные сервисы через один профиль. Пользователь записывается в новом приложении через аккаунт социальной сети. Система принимает первичную информацию и создает учетную запись за несколько секунд. Исчезает потребность удерживать массу паролей.

Интегрированные карты в программах такси демонстрируют путь перемещения шофера. Сервис перевозки еды показывает адрес ресторана и длительность готовки. Интернет-магазин дает платеж через платежную систему прямо на странице товара. Каждая интеграция уменьшает переключения между программами.

Интеллектуальные ассистенты консолидируют возможности десятков программ в голосовом интерфейсе. Запрос активирует музыку, бронирует такси или вносит позиции в список. Пользователь регулирует сервисами через единственную точку входа. Технологии функционируют незаметно, формируя впечатление единого продукта.

Образцы API в обычных сервисах

Картографические сервисы дают интерфейсы для внедрения карт в внешние приложения pokerdom. Рестораны демонстрируют свое местоположение на сайте через интеграцию. Сервисы перевозки рассчитывают дистанцию и прокладывают наилучшие маршруты. Агрегаторы недвижимости показывают объекты на интерактивной карте.

Платежные системы предоставляют софтверные интерфейсы для получения онлайн-платежей. Интернет-магазины принимают оплату картами без собственной структуры. Мобильные приложения присоединяют электронные кошельки для быстрых операций. Благотворительные фонды собирают пожертвования через защищенные интерфейсы.

Социальные сети позволяют выкладывать контент из иных приложений. Музыкальные сервисы публикуют композициями в ленте друзей единственным касанием. Фитнес-трекеры выкладывают успехи тренировок автоматически. Игровые площадки отображают результаты и приглашают друзей.

Метеорологические сервисы пересылают прогнозы в программы для организации. Туристические агрегаторы рассматривают погоду при выборе направлений. Фермерские системы анализируют метеоданные для оптимизации орошения. Транспортные организации корректируют расписание с учётом метеоусловий.

Как выполняется запрос и прием данных

Алгоритм запускается с формирования запроса клиентским приложением покердом казино. Приложение генерирует запрос с указанием необходимой операции и параметров. Обращение передается на определенный адрес сервера по сетевому протоколу. В заголовках отправляется информация о типе данных и методе обработки.

Сервер получает входящий обращение и контролирует полномочия доступа отправителя. Система аутентификации контролирует ключи доступа или токены авторизации. После положительной верификации сервер изучает параметры обращения. Программа извлекает нужную информацию из хранилища данных или осуществляет необходимые операции.

Генерация результата происходит в организованном формате данных. Сервер упаковывает результаты в JSON или XML документ. К ответу присоединяется код статуса операции и добавочные метаданные. Корректный запрос выдает код 200, сбои отмечаются кодами 400 или 500.

Клиентское приложение принимает ответ и выделяет нужную данные. Программа верифицирует код статуса и обрабатывает вероятные ошибки. Сведения преобразуются в комфортный для отображения формат. Пользователь замечает результат в интерфейсе приложения через доли секунды после создания обращения.

Лимиты и безопасность API

Собственники сервисов задают квоты на число запросов от одного клиента. Лимиты оберегают серверы от переполнения и нарушений. Бесплатные тарифы позволяют выполнять несколько тысяч запросов в день. Коммерческие тарифы убирают ограничения за плату.

Верификация проверяет идентичность программы покердом перед открытием доступа. Разработчики приобретают уникальные ключи при регистрации. Каждый обращение включает специальный токен для идентификации. Система блокирует запросы без действительных учетных сведений.

Криптография охраняет транслируемую сведения от захвата атакующими. Нынешние интерфейсы действуют лишь через безопасное соединение HTTPS. Протокол защищает информацию между клиентом и сервером. Банковские системы задействуют добавочные ступени охраны.

Регулирование доступа определяет доступные действия для определенного программы. Социальная сеть разрешает просмотр профиля, но блокирует стирание профиля. Платежная система дает уточнить баланс, но маскирует данные карты. Точечные права минимизируют угрозы при раскрытии информации. Регулярный анализ находит бреши до их эксплуатации.

Отчего бизнесу требуются интеграции между системами

Автоматизация бизнес-процессов сокращает время выполнения типовых операций pokerdom. Заявка из интернет-магазина автоматически попадает в систему складского учета. Бухгалтерия получает данные о транзакциях без ручного ввода. Сотрудники избавляются от монотонной деятельности и концентрируются на значимых заданиях.

Единое информационное поле устраняет повторение информации в разных системах. Изменение контактов клиента обновляется во всех связанных приложениях. Достоверность данных улучшает уровень сервиса. Ошибки из-за устаревших данных становятся редкостью.

Масштабирование бизнеса упрощается благодаря блочной структуре. Компания интегрирует новые сервисы без реорганизации инфраструктуры. Расширение на новые территории предполагает интеграции с локальными платежными системами. Существующие интерфейсы ускоряют выход на новые территории.

Анализ консолидированных сведений обеспечивает исчерпывающую представление активности организации. Маркетинговая система покердом казино получает сведения о приобретениях для кастомизации. Финансовый подразделение оценивает рентабельность путей реализации. Управление выносит вердикты на основе консолидированных докладов. Интеграции преобразуют обособленные системы в единый механизм.

We will be happy to hear your thoughts

Leave a reply

Find the latest coupons, discount codes, promo codes, and referral codes from your favorite stores. Save up to 80% from our thousands of exclusive codes.

©2024 promosaver.net. All rights reserved.

Promo Saver - Coupons, Promo Codes, and Discount Codes
Logo